Transaction 1037f82d39310e0c1dd3caffd98695e58210bf0d7b323031181e16e18a725311
1 Input
1 Output
-
1037f82d39310e0c1dd3caffd98695e58210bf0d7b323031181e16e18a725311:0
- value
- 135433358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b75fc922b33a1f524724c5029cea9a841490633 OP_EQUAL
- address
- 3EQRC4WGQMsHH1iwrgUcGhFYDfAYmq1hMw